Product Description
Bringing you the Enjoi Hassler Bag Of Suck 8.25" Skateboard Deck, the ultimate deck for skateboard enthusiasts. This deck is designed to provide you with the best riding experience, allowing you to perform tricks and maneuvers with ease.
Crafted with precision and attention to detail, the Enjoi Hassler Bag Of Suck deck features a full shape, providing you with a wider nose and tail for increased space and stability when positioning your feet. This means you can confidently land your tricks and maintain balance while riding.
Constructed using Enjoi's Resin 7 technology, this deck is made from 7 plies of Canadian hardrock maple. The Resin 7 construction ensures that each board is identical to its brother on the shelf, resulting in a consistent and high-quality product. The gnarly epoxy used in the construction allows for more strength with less glue, making the deck lighter, stiffer, and longer lasting than traditional 7-ply construction decks.
Specifications:
- Width: 8.25"
- Construction: Enjoi Resin 7
